2005-12-29 - Identified through online information from James R. Stettner. -- This organ was moved to St. Patrick's Catholic in Granger, Washington. by an undocumented person or firm at an undocumented date. St. Patrick's has since been renamed Our Lady of Guadalupe. -Database Manager

NOTES
This organ was originally built for this location.

It was sold to St. Patrick's (now, Our Lady of Guadalupe) in Granger, Washington ca.
1966 when St. Andrew's sold their property. The Moller was installed in Granger an
unknown person or firm.

The flute unit is a combination of stopped wood, capped metal and tapered open metal 
pipes. The top 7 pipes of the flute unit (2' extension) break back to 4' pitch.
